At Universal Quantum we aim to make the world a better place by developing new computer technology. Together, we are creating truly impactful quantum computers. Our machines will be capable of solving problems until now considered impossible, with applications ranging across a broad range of industries including healthcare, materials and aerospace. We are looking to hire a digitaldesign engineer, to work with the system lead on digital FPGA (or ASIC) designs.Passionate about helping create technologies which can change the world? We may be the right place for you so get in touch!
What You'll Accomplish:
* Design blocks/sub-systems/FPGAs at RTL levelfrom high-level requirements provided by the system lead
* Take ownership of block/sub-systems/system level specifications and architecture, design and implementation
* Generate comprehensive documentation required for design and verification
* Perform FPGA top-level/sub-system level verification
* Participate in design reviews involving a larger cross-functional team
Requirements
The 3 Most Critical Attributes We'll Use to Compare Candidates:
* Experience in complex block/sub-system RTL design (Verilog/VHDL)
* Ability to take full ownership of sub-system/FPGA development and contribute to the definition of the architecture
* Ability to work independently(individual contributor/sub-system lead) and work collaboratively across a multi-functional team
Must-have Skills:
* 8+ years of digital RTL design and verification experience
* Competency in scripting languages Python/Tcl/shell
* Excellent interpersonal and communication skills
* Demonstrate a strong discipline for thorough documentation
* Ability to work autonomously, setting priorities & delivering to schedule
* Degree or equivalent - Electronics / Computer Science or a related discipline
Nice-to-have Skills:
* Previous experience of both FPGA and ASIC design flows
* System-level design/architecture experience
* Experience with DSP tools
* Background or understanding in Physics, including quantum technologies
